1.  north river lobster company.

North River Lobster Company

During the summer,  North River Lobster Company  (New York City’s beloved floating seafood restaurant since 2014) offers four daily sailings at 1pm, 3pm, 5pm and 7pm from Wednesday to Sunday every week. Afternoon cruises are 1 hour and the 7pm cruise is a two-hour route to the Statue of Liberty and back —how beautiful! On the menu: Maine Lobster Rolls, seafood platters, burgers, and ready-to-share appetizers. New menu items this year include tuna tartare, clam dip and chips, The Skagen shrimp roll, and sweet lobster clawsicles in four different flavors (mango, piña colada, strawberry and lime). The best deal on board may be the $17 glass of rosé and 3 oyster special, or you can go all out with the epic 28-inch lobster roll (dubbed the world’s largest lobster roll) for $149, to feed a group.

7.  La Barca Cantina

La Barca Cantina

La Barca Cantina , the only Mexican restaurant on a boat in NYC, serves a summer street food-inspired menu that’ll get the party started for you and your friends. Based at Pier 81, next to its sister-restaurant North River Lobster Company, La Barca spans three levels with an expansive outdoor top deck with a bar and table seating, a bi-level interior space with two bars, table seating and booth-like tables—perfect for large groups.  Even better, it takes short cruises multiple times per day, five days a week, offering up sweeping views of the NYC skyline. (It's a must to reserve a table for cocktails at sunset.)
